debian/pcscd.{postinst,postrm}: remove these now useless files.

The /etc/readeer.conf file is no more used since 1.6.0-1. These files
can be removed since wheezy (actual stable).
This commit is contained in:
Ludovic Rousseau 2014-05-14 12:29:02 +00:00
parent ba190eaf3a
commit 2bbf65b095
3 changed files with 3 additions and 46 deletions

3
debian/changelog vendored
View File

@ -3,6 +3,9 @@ pcsc-lite (1.8.11-2) unstable; urgency=medium
* Fix "pcscd should rely on dh-systemd to enable the socket" let dh-systemd
do its work. The package already Build-Depends: dh-systemd
(Closes: #748047)
* debian/pcscd.{postinst,postrm}: remove these now useless files.
The /etc/readeer.conf file is no more used since 1.6.0-1. These files
can be removed since wheezy (actual stable).
-- Ludovic Rousseau <rousseau@debian.org> Wed, 14 May 2014 14:24:06 +0200

19
debian/pcscd.postinst vendored
View File

@ -1,19 +0,0 @@
#!/bin/sh
set -e
OLDCFGFILE=/etc/reader.conf
CFGDIR=/var/lib/pcscd
CFGFILE="$CFGDIR/reader.conf"
# /etc/reader.conf is no more used
if [ -f $OLDCFGFILE ]; then
mv $OLDCFGFILE $OLDCFGFILE.old
fi
# remove /var/lib/pcscd
if [ -d $CFGDIR ]; then
rm -rf $CFGDIR
fi
#DEBHELPER#

27
debian/pcscd.postrm vendored
View File

@ -1,27 +0,0 @@
#!/bin/sh
set -e
if [ "$1" = "purge" ] ; then
# Remove configuration file
if [ -f /etc/reader.conf ]; then
rm -f /etc/reader.conf
fi
# Remove configuration file backup
if [ -f /etc/reader.conf.old ]; then
rm -f /etc/reader.conf.old
fi
# remove cfgdir if it's not in use
if [ -d /etc/reader.conf.d ]; then
files=`ls /etc/reader.conf.d`
if [ -z "$files" ]; then
rmdir /etc/reader.conf.d
fi
fi
fi
#DEBHELPER#